Output 45bf0ee447145e8ec85b10095494404768e61f05002ab14a6e61a5c6fda985cd:369

value
568826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02d2260bb0a609369f526d5a76cc99c6e7f153bc OP_EQUAL
address
31ww2JtVBs5P6DAheZ343R4hgYN8A55NQA
transaction
45bf0ee447145e8ec85b10095494404768e61f05002ab14a6e61a5c6fda985cd
spent
true